**亚太CDN请求重定向策略的演进与革新**,随着互联网技术的飞速发展,CDN作为加速网络访问的关键工具,在亚太地区得到广泛应用,CDN请求重定向策略经历了从简单重定向到智能、动态重定向的转变,实现了服务的高效、稳定和个性化,近年来,借助AI与大数据技术,重定向策略正进一步演进与革新,精准识别用户需求与网络状况,实现动态资源调度和智能路由选择,提升用户体验的同时保障了服务的高可用性。
亚太CDN(内容分发网络)的请求重定向策略可以根据具体的业务需求和网络环境进行定制,以下是一些常见的请求重定向策略:
从指路到领航,亚太CDN请求重定向策略的演进与革新
- 基于URL的静态重定向:
- 根据客户端的请求URL,将其重定向到指定的目标URL。
- 将
http://example.com/a.html重定向到http://www.example.com/b.html。
- 基于路径的动态重定向:
- 根据请求的路径信息,将其重定向到不同的目标URL。
- 将
/old-path重定向到/new-path。
- 基于HTTP状态的代码重定向:
- 使用HTTP状态码(如301永久重定向、302临时重定向等)来指示客户端请求的资源已经被移动到一个新的URL。
- 使用301重定向将
http://example.com/page1永久重定向到http://www.example.com/page2。
- 基于域名的重定向:
- 如果客户端访问的是一个子域名,可以将其重定向到主域名。
- 将
http://sub.example.com/page1重定向到http://example.com/page1。
- 基于客户端的地理位置进行重定向:
- 根据客户的地理位置,将其重定向到最近的服务节点或最优的网络路径。
- 这通常需要结合CDN提供商的智能路由功能来实现。
- 基于请求头信息的重定向:
- 根据请求头中的特定信息(如User-Agent、Accept-Language等),进行针对性的重定向。
- 将来自移动设备的请求重定向到适合移动浏览器的页面。
- 基于流量的重定向:
- 根据网站的流量情况,动态调整重定向策略,在高流量时,可以将部分请求重定向到更稳定或更优化的服务器上。
在实施这些重定向策略时,需要注意以下几点:
- 确保重定向操作的准确性和及时性,避免用户长时间等待无法访问的资源。
- 考虑重定向对用户体验的影响,避免不必要的重定向导致网站加载速度变慢或出现错误。
- 监控和分析重定向的效果,根据实际情况不断优化和调整重定向策略。
具体的亚太CDN提供商可能会有自己独特的重定向策略和服务,建议在使用前详细咨询提供商的技术支持团队,以获取最适合您业务需求的解决方案。
分发网络(CDN)深度融合的今天,用户点击一个链接,到内容呈现在屏幕上,背后经历了一场无声却复杂的“导航战争”,在这其中,请求重定向策略既是CDN的指路牌,也是其调度智慧的集中体现,尤其在亚太地区——一个网络环境碎片化、节点分布复杂、跨境流量密集的区域,重定向策略不仅关乎性能,更关乎成本、合规与用户体验的最终落地。
亚太CDN的独特挑战:为什么重定向如此关键?
不同于欧美相对统一的网络生态,亚太CDN场景呈现出“高度异构”的特点:
- 地理与网络碎片化:从东京的成熟光纤网,到雅加达的移动优先网络,再到缅甸的卫星回传,不同地区的接入带宽、延迟、丢包率天差地别。
- 跨境流量瓶颈:企业出海、游戏加速、视频直播的业务需要频繁跨越亚太各国的IPB(互联网交换点),而国际出口带宽昂贵且易受海缆故障影响。
- 边缘节点资源不均衡:一线城市(新加坡、香港、东京)节点密集,但二线及以下城市(如曼谷、胡志明市、马尼拉)往往依赖少量边缘节点或回源。
- 合规与本地化要求:数据主权法规(如印度、越南的数据本地化要求)使得必须将流量精准重定向至符合当地法律的节点,而非单纯追求最低延迟。
在此背景下,重定向策略不再是简单的“就近分配”,而是一场需要综合考量网络质量、成本、合规与突发弹性的复杂决策。
从DNS到HTTP:重定向策略的两大战场
当前的亚太CDN重定向策略,主要分为DNS级重定向与HTTP级重定向(含301/302、CNAME转发等)两大类。
DNS级重定向:第一道分水岭
用户在浏览器输入域名时,由CDN的授权DNS服务器返回一个最匹配的节点IP,这是“粗粒度”调度,通常基于用户的IP归属地(GeoIP)和EDNS子网(ECS,即客户端子网信息)进行定位。
- 挑战:亚太地区IP地址复用和NAT(网络地址转换)现象严重,例如大量印尼用户通过新加坡的出口IP上网,DNS调度可能将其错误引导至新加坡节点;ECS虽能改善,但仍无法精确感知末端网络的实时抖动。
HTTP级重定向:精细化导航
当用户请求到达CDN的“第一跳”节点后,如果该节点不适合(如即将过载、不是命中缓存、或用户地理位置更接近另一个节点),CDN会返回一个302状态码,指示用户重新请求另一个URL或IP。
- 实战场景:在“边缘容灾”中,如果香港节点因海底光缆中断而延迟飙升,收到请求的香港节点会立即发起HTTP重定向,将用户引向台北或新加坡节点,而非让用户等待超时。
- 应用层重定向:针对移动端APP,很多CDN厂商会采用HTTP头中的
X-Location自定义字段,配合客户端SDK实现“服务端决定路径,客户端执行跳转”的闭环。
深水区:个性化与动态化策略的落地
在亚太市场,任何“一刀切”的重定向策略都可能引发性能雪崩,先进的CDN平台开始在以下方面深化策略:
基于实时网络质量的红黑名单机制
传统策略依赖静态拓扑计算,而亚太网络动态变化极快,现代CDN在边缘节点上部署了RTT(往返延迟)探测、丢包率监测与BGP(边界网关协议)路由反射器,能动态维护一张“实时可用节点地图”,某游戏公司在东南亚的运营,当检测到菲律宾Tier-1节点带宽接近阈值时,调度系统自动将该节点设为“黑名单”,将其覆盖的用户请求通过重定向引导至马来西亚节点,从而避免因拥塞导致的重传率恶化。
成本-性能多目标优化
重定向并非只看延迟,亚太地区部分节点(如澳大利亚、日本)的带宽进价显著高于东南亚,策略引擎需权衡:“为了降低20ms延迟,是否值得付出两倍的带宽成本?” 这使得重定向策略从单一的“性能最优”变为“客户定义的SLA综合最优”,视频直播场景可容忍延迟稍高但必须保证流畅度,则重定向会优先链路丢包率低于0.5%的节点;而金融交易则需要绝对低延迟,不惜成本。
元数据驱动的路径纠错
在跨境电商场景中,用户的行为数据(如浏览商品类别、所在语言区域)有时比IP地址更能反映其真实体验需求,CDN的请求重定向策略开始与企业的用户画像系统联动,当检测到来自越南胡志明市的用户正在访问中文商品页面,系统会将其请求重定向到拥有亚太中文内容缓存的边缘节点(如新加坡或东京),而非胡志明市的本地节点(因为后者可能更适合本地语言内容),从而提升冷启动命中率。
未来趋势:从“被动响应”迈向“主动预判”
随着亚太地区5G、边缘计算与物联网的爆发,请求重定向策略正进入“自进化”阶段:
- ML(机器学习)驱动的预测性重定向:系统不再仅根据当前网络情况重定向,而是利用历史数据训练模型,预测未来5分钟内的节点负载与网络波动,提前进行流量调度(在印尼雨季到来前,自动调高部分节点的冗余比例,并将高优先级流量预重定向至备用链路)。
- 与业务负载的深度联动:重定向策略开始理解“内容层级”——游戏通关界面的请求与启动画面的请求权重不同,CDN可以针对关键请求(如支付跳转、战斗结算)采用高成本但低抖动的重定向路径,而对静态图片则接受一定程度的延迟。
- 去中心化的决策协同:未来的CDN架构中,边缘节点之间会通过轻量级协议交换各自的“健康状态”与“用户偏好”,从而实现类似“蜂群”的协同重定向,无需中心调度器干预。
在亚太这片充满活力的土地上,CDN的请求重定向早已超越“技术实现”,成为一种融合了网络工程、成本经济学与商业逻辑的系统工程,每一次重定向,都是对用户、内容与网络三者关系的重新权衡,随着系统越来越智能,这些看似微小的302状态码,将成为确保亚太数字体验流畅运行的无形指挥家。
